### **Final opponent check:

Kraken Robotics vs. Exail Technologies**
We're taking off the kid gloves. Here is the ultimate comparison between the Canadian aggressor **Kraken Robotics (PNG.V)** and the French defense bulwark **Exail Technologies (EXA.PA)**. We analyze fact-based on the basis of data from **April 13, 2026**.

#### **1st Financial Check & Multiples**
| Key figure | Kraken Robotics (KRK) | Exail Technologies (EXA) | Analysis: Sharp-Shooter |

| **Share price** | **~6.10 CAD** | **~123.30 €** | Kraken is visually "cheap", Exail is a heavyweight. |

** **Market capitalization** | **~2.58 bn CAD** | **~2.10 bn €** | Kraken is massively inflated by the Covelya takeover. |

** **KGV (Forward)** | **~137x** | **~32x (adj. for 2026)** | Kraken is a "hope bubble"; Exail is fairly valued for quality. |

| **Net Debt / EBITDA** | **~3.4x (estimate)** | **~1.2x** | **Security:** Exail is solid, Kraken is highly leveraged. |

| **ROIC** | **~6.1%** | **~15.5%** | Exail creates real value; Kraken burns capital for expansion. |

#### **2. Margin Staircase (The Naked Truth)**

* **Exail Technologies:**
* **EBITDA margin:** Rising to **~25%** (Guidance 2026).
* **FCF margin:** **~18.4%**. You print money with every system sold.
** **Status:** **GOLD STANDARD PASSED**.

* **Kraken Robotics:**
** **EBITDA margin:** **~12 %** (post-merger print).
** **FCF margin:** **NEGATIVE** to stagnating. The interest burden of the $150m credit line for Covelya and the integration costs eat up every cent.
* **Status:**
**FAILED**.

#### **3rd Piotroski F-Score**

* **Exactly:** **8 out of 9.** A paragon of balance discipline.

* **Kraken:** **3 out of 9.** Massive red flags: declining liquidity, exploding debt and brutal dilution from the recent capital increase.

#### **4th Dividend & Shareholder Check**

* **Exactly:** Consistent re-investment focus. No dividend, but massive value growth per share without dilution.

* **Kraken:** **Hostile to shareholders** **The 615 million takeover was financed on the backs of existing shareholders. Your share was mercilessly diluted in March 2026.

#### **5th regions & Moat**

* **Exail (The Moat):** **System integrator.** They build the complete autonomous ships for navies (Belgium, Netherlands, Singapore). A change of supplier would take decades. This is **monopoly-like protection**.

* **Kraken (The niche):** **Component supplier.** They have great sensors (SAS), but they are interchangeable if a system integrator like Exail or Thales develops their own solution or buys in.

#### **6. Risks & "dirt on the ground "**

** **Kraken:** **The takeover trauma** The integration of Covelya is a "suicide mission". If the synergies do not take effect within 12 months, the house of cards will collapse under the burden of debt.

* The only risk is that they won't be able to deliver fast enough because of all the orders (>€1.1 billion backlog). A luxury problem.

#### **7. DCF analysis (fair value)**

* **Exact (EUR):** Fair value at **~€145.00**. Currently at €123.30 a clear **buy**.

** **Kraken (CAD):** Fair value (based on cash flows, not hope) at **~3.80 CAD**. At 6.10 CAD the share is **massively overheated**.
